RSPU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2020 in Review
68 of the 4,956 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Invesco S&P 500 Equal Weight Utilities ETF (RSPU) for Q3 2020, worth a combined $72M — down 18% from $87.8M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 12 funds closed out of RSPU and 5 opened new positions — a net loss of 7 holders — while 33 trimmed existing stakes and 14 added.
The largest buyer was Susquehanna International Group, adding an estimated $1.02M. The largest seller was IMC Chicago, exiting entirely with an estimated $3.01M sold.
